TMGM provides MetaTrader 4 and 5, which are popular among Portugal traders for their intuitive interface, advanced charting, and automated trading via Expert Advisors (EAs). Interactive Brokers offers its proprietary Trader Workstation (TWS), which is powerful but complex, with a steep learning curve. For Portugal retail traders, TMGM's MT4/5 are easier to use and offer faster order execution. IB's platform excels in multi-asset trading and research tools, ideal for sophisticated investors. Both brokers have mobile apps, but TMGM's is more streamlined for on-the-go trading. If you value simplicity and speed, TMGM wins; for comprehensive analysis and diverse instruments, choose Interactive Brokers.

For Portugal Muslim traders seeking swap-free accounts, TMGM offers Islamic accounts with no overnight interest charges on positions held beyond a day, complying with Sharia law. These accounts are available on request and cover most forex pairs and CFDs. Interactive Brokers does not provide standard Islamic accounts, but you can contact their support to discuss potential accommodations, though it's not guaranteed. TMGM is the clear winner for Portugal traders requiring Islamic accounts, as it has a straightforward process and transparent terms. Always confirm with customer support before opening an account.
